Two men arrested in €1.94 million cannabis seizure

Two men were arrested yesterday (Wednesday) in a Garda operation targetting an organised crime gang operating in the Meath area.

As part of ongoing investigations targeting the gang a joint operation was conducted by personnel attached to the Garda National Drugs and Organised Crime Bureau (GNDOCB), the Meath Divisional Drugs Unit and the Revenue Customs Service.

During the course of this operation a premises was searched in the Rathfeigh area and 97 kgs of herbal cannabis with an estimated street value of €1.94 million was seized by Revenue Officers.

Gardaí arrested a 59 year old male and a 61 year old male at the scene.

Both males are currently detained at Ashbourne Garda station.
